Learn key facts about Postgraduate Certificate in Educational Leadership and Child Growth
The Postgraduate Certificate in Educational Leadership and Child Growth is a specialized program designed for educators and professionals seeking to enhance their knowledge and skills in leading educational institutions and promoting child development.
This program focuses on equipping learners with the necessary expertise to create supportive learning environments, foster positive relationships with students, and develop effective strategies for promoting child growth and well-being.
Upon completion of the program, learners can expect to achieve the following learning outcomes:
they will be able to analyze complex educational issues, develop and implement evidence-based solutions, and evaluate the impact of their leadership decisions on student outcomes.
The duration of the Postgraduate Certificate in Educational Leadership and Child Growth typically ranges from 6 to 12 months, depending on the institution and the learner's prior experience and qualifications.
